Re: RoboRIO in stock at AM

I loaded up a machine with LabVIEW 2013 on it and was able to find the roboRIO in NI MAX. You can use NI MAX to install LabVIEW RT 2013 to the target, which also installs the Linux OS. From there you can enable the sshd in MAX as well and you should have access to log into the roboRIO and play with the OS. Naturally this is the OS from over a year ago, not the newer version that will be included in the FRC images. There are a number of differences, but there are more similarities, so you can gain some familiarity with the layout of the file system. This is only if you want to tinker with the system before kick-off. You won't have FPGA support, so you can't talk to any I/O. When you get the image on kick-off day, you will be formatting the root FS, so don't expect to keep any changes you may make to this older version of the OS.

Bottom line, if you really want to play with Linux on the target, do this. If you expect to "use" the device to "do something", this won't help you.

Re: RoboRIO in stock at AM

Quote:
Originally Posted by adciv View Post
How are you rebooting the RoboRIO? The RoboRIO uses a journaling file system and the settings are only saved if you perform a soft restart (e.g. log into RIO from the webpage and click restart). If you do a power cycle without this, the settings are not saved.
I'm referring to the case where there is no OS installed at all (such as how they will arrive from the factory). There will be no OS running out of the UBIFS... instead it will boot into safe-mode which runs out of a RAM disk. Any changes you make to the running system will be lost on reboot. It is true that you can save files to the UBIFS while in safe mode (this is part of what makes it useful... access to the rootfs to attempt to fix them, or to recover data files before format). Any files written there will be persisted after a clean shutdown.
